Output 148667439384eff6faf34cb0e26108d46472ac0733e0e1f96c775fd962bf36c3:0

value
1043488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56eaa18a15d02d24651e8039d358df869783dde0 OP_EQUAL
address
39cb7VMrA4J8uyDG3qVB43GQMDSmQi2jWU
transaction
148667439384eff6faf34cb0e26108d46472ac0733e0e1f96c775fd962bf36c3
spent
true